Pandai Crowned First-Ever WITSA World Cup Champion at WCIT 2024

Pandai made history by becoming the inaugural WITSA World Cup Champion at the recent WCIT 2024 held in Yerevan, Armenia. This prestigious event showcased the most innovative tech solutions globally, and Pandai stood out among fierce competition from 16 teams across eight countries, including Armenia, Bahrain, Egypt, Greece, Romania, Spain, Jordan, and the United Kingdom. The Zohari Challenge Trophy was awarded to Pandai’s CEO, Khairul Anwar, for his compelling final pitch that highlighted the app’s impact on education through gamification and personalized learning tools.

About WITSA

The World Innovation, Technology, and Services Alliance (WITSA) was founded in 1978 with the goal of driving innovation and fostering growth within the global tech industry. WITSA advocates for international public policies that support the advancement of the technology sector by promoting international trade and investment. The WITSA World Cup is part of the organization’s Excellence Awards, which recognize impactful digital innovations that drive meaningful change in various industries.

About Pandai

Founded in 2020, Pandai has quickly established itself as a key player in the educational technology space. The company was born out of a desire to make quality education more accessible and engaging through technology. The Pandai app employs intelligent personalization and gamification to enhance learning outcomes for students, making studying more enjoyable and effective.

Since its inception, Pandai has participated in the prestigious Y Combinator accelerator program, secured over RM10 million in funding from global investors, and won multiple international awards. With a focus on innovation, Pandai is committed to revolutionizing education for primary and secondary students.
